Naomi Frears: In Other Words
More information

Naomi Frears explores the expressive and communicative qualities of sleeves and arms

The short film draws on the artist’s research into RAMM’s historic costume and fine art collections. Taking inspiration from the range of sleeves in paintings, prints, and fashion illustrations, this new work explores the infinite possibilities of non-verbal language through arm movement, with sleeves framing every gesture and communication.

Frears describes her process of creating the work as being “fascinated by arms and hands as communicative parts of the body… Sleeves have become arms moving in sleeves – arms that can signal and describe, push away, embrace, and even talk without words.”
